The Typical Suspects: A/c Issues to See For

  • Refrigerant Leaks: This is like your AC's lifeline. Low refrigerant implies bad cooling. Did you understand a small leakage can snowball into a major issue?
  • Dirty Air Filters: Blocked filters limit airflow, making your a/c work harder. It resembles trying to breathe through a stuffy nose!
  • Frozen Evaporator Coils: This can happen due to restricted air flow or low refrigerant. Envision your a/c trying to cool itself to death!
  • Faulty Fan Motor: If the fan isn't blowing correctly, your AC will not cool efficiently. This can result in getting too hot and more damage.
  • Compressor Issues: The compressor is the heart of your air conditioner. If it stops working, your air conditioning is essentially out of commission.
  • Drainage Issues: A stopped up drain line can result in water damage and even mold development.

When to Call a Pro: Indications You Required AC Repair Work

Often, it's appealing to DIY, but with air conditioning repairs, it's typically best to call in the cavalry. Here are some dead giveaways that require a specialist's attention:

  1. Weak Air flow: If the air coming from your vents feels weak, there could be a clog or a problem with the fan.
  2. Strange Sounds: Banging, rattling, or hissing noises are never ever a great sign.
  3. Unusual Smells: A moldy or burning smell could indicate mold, electrical issues, or other serious problems.
  4. Irregular Cooling: Are some rooms colder than others? This might indicate ductwork problems or a stopping working compressor.
  5. Higher Energy Expenses: A sudden spike in your energy expense might mean your air conditioner is working more difficult than it should.

Translating Accreditations and Licenses

Browsing the world of HVAC accreditations can feel like deciphering a secret code. Look beyond flashy marketing. Is the service technician EPA-certified!.?.!? This is crucial, especially when handling refrigerants, as incorrect handling can cause environmental damage and fines. A North American Specialist Excellence (NATE) certification indicates a higher level of proficiency, reflecting extensive screening and understanding. Remember, a piece of paper doesn't guarantee proficiency. It's a starting point.

  • Confirm the certification is existing and valid.
  • Inquire about the specialist's experience with your specific air conditioner system design.
  • Don't hesitate to request evidence of insurance coverage and licensing.

The Diagnostic Deep Dive

That initial service call? It's more than just a friendly "hello." It's a diagnostic exploration. A seasoned specialist will delve into the heart of your AC system, armed with multimeters and refrigerant evaluates, seeking the source of the trouble. The complexity of this investigation straight affects the expense. A basic clogged up filter is a fast repair; a refrigerant leakage needs customized devices and expertise, bumping up the preliminary investment. Think about it as a detective resolving a secret-- the more elaborate the clues, the more time (and money) it takes to crack the case.

Parts and the Perils of Procurement

The malfunctioning element-- the capacitor on its last legs, the blower motor wheezing its last breath-- requires changing. And here's where the plot thickens. The cost of the part itself varies wildly depending upon its type, producer, and accessibility. Some parts are readily offered, stocked locally, while others require an across the country search, possibly including shipping costs and delays. Moreover, older or odd systems may demand sourcing vintage or refurbished parts, a process that can be both lengthy and pricey. What looks like a small part can turn into a significant expense consideration.

The Refrigerant Riddle

Ah, refrigerant-- the lifeline of your air conditioner system. If your system is low, it signifies a leak, which's where things get tricky. Not only do you have the expense of the refrigerant itself (which varies based upon type and accessibility), but you also have the labor included in locating and fixing the leak. Furthermore, older refrigerants are being phased out due to ecological issues, making them increasingly costly and hard to source. Changing them with contemporary, eco-friendly options may be an essential but substantial investment. A leakage isn't simply a convenience concern; it's a possible financial problem waiting to occur.

  • Air Filter: Replace it every 1-3 months. A dirty filter limits airflow, making your system work harder and potentially freeze up.
  • Coil Cleaning: A minimum of when a year, clean the outdoor condenser coil. Use a fin comb to straighten bent fins for optimum airflow.
  • Drain Pipes Line Check: Guarantee the condensate drain line is clear. Algae and particles can obstruct it, causing water damage.
  • Check Electrical Wiring: Look for torn wires or loose connections. Electrical concerns can be harmful and cause system failure.

Uncommon Issues and Specialist Solutions

Among the greatest oversights is ignoring the blower motor. In time, dust and particles accumulate, reducing its effectiveness and potentially causing it to overheat. An indication? A burning smell when the a/c kicks on. Another often-missed problem is refrigerant leakages.

Low refrigerant levels cause the system to work harder, resulting in compressor failure which is a substantial cost. If you observe ice forming on the refrigerant lines, that's a red flag. Mentioning flags, another indicator that your system might require professional attention is uncommon sounds. A rattling noise could show loose parts, while a hissing noise may imply a refrigerant leakage.
